Job Description

JOB PURPOSE
OVERSEES
IN-KIND DONATION PRODUCTION FOR THE VEHICLE PROGRAM
by facilitating change to meet internal and external customer needs, improving efficiency and reduce costs; developing and maintains production staff and vendors; providing communication to internal and external parties; assuming risk management; providing a learning environment for the work experience program; developing and maintaining production staff and budget; expanding production knowledge; overseeing technician positions in the shop.
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
1.
DEVELOPS PRODUCTION STAFF AND VENDORS
by by providing training, supervision, coaching, encouragement, and discipline to staff involved in the production processes, product segmentation, detailing, and repairs in order to meet production goals, objectives, and outcomes; providing information and input pertinent to department decision making; recommending options and courses of action. 2.
MAINTAINS PRODUCTION CAPACITY BASED ON INTERNAL AND EXTERNAL CUSTOMER NEEDS
By providing vendor and staff planning and development; writing job descriptions needed for development plans. 3.
MAINTAINS RAWHIDE FLEET AND DOT INSPECTIONS ALONG WITH STATE REGISTRATIONS
by Inspecting automotive vehicles to ensure compliance to state standards and governmental regulations; interprets related state laws and regulations to help ensure the fleet's compliance. 4.
MAINTAINS PROFESSIONAL AND TECHNICAL KNOWLEDGE
by Completing required trainings; attending educational workshops; reviewing professional publications; establishing personal networks; participating in professional societies. 5.
MAINTAINS STAFF JOB RESULTS
by training and coaching support staff; establishing staff goals, monitoring progress, and providing feedback; appraising job results. 6.
PROTECTS THE CREDIBILITY OF THE RAWHIDE MISSION
by complying with the Rawhide standard of conduct; setting an example, in words and actions, that is consistent with the values and beliefs of Rawhide. 7.
CONTRIBUTES TO TEAM EFFORT
by performing other duties as directed or assigned by supervisor.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S
Train and develop production staff on proper processes and procedures Coordinate production schedule ensuring accurate amounts of materials and supplies are available for production work
JOB QUALIFICATIONS
Associate's degree in a related field, 1 year of production management experience, 3 years of production/assembly line experience, or willingness to complete training through Rawhide's LMS system Strong leadership, administrative, and customer service skills Demonstrated ability to manage budgetary restraints and safety regulations
